EN6482 New Technologies in Language Teaching. Friday, March 28, 2008. Learner Autonomy and Tandem Learning. The author first clarified a few misconceptions of learner autonomy. Then he defined learner autonomy as a learner's capacity for critical self-evaluation and self-determination, an ability to take control over and responsibility for her learning. Saturday, April 12, 2008. Week 12 Reflection: Technology in testing: the present and the future. There have been more tested delivered by computer since the 90s' like the Computer-based Test (CBT) TOFEL. One of the major drawback of CBT is that candidates have to be given chance to get familiar with the use of computer in the test setting and it will not be fair if candidates are not computer-literate ready for it.
